Python ve Editörler
Editörler: Kod yazmak, saklamak, düzenlemek ve geliştirmek için kullandığımız
programlardır.
Hangi editörleri kullanmalıyız?
programlardır.
Hangi editörleri kullanmalıyız?
IDLE:
Python.org web sitesinde yer alan ücretsiz bir Python editörüdür.
2 Python programlama diline yeni başlayanların en sık yaptığı hatalardan biri kaydetmek istedikleri kodları IDLE ekranına yazmaya çalışmalarıdır. Burada yazdığımız kodlar ekranı kapattığımızda kaybolur. IDLE’ı açtığınızda sol üst köşede File [Dosya] menüsüne tıklayın ve New Window [Yeni Pencere] düğmesine basın. Beyaz bir ekranla karşılaşacaksınız. İşte asıl kodlarımızı bu ekrana yazacağız.
3 Python’a yeni başlayanların en sık yaptığı hatalardan biri de >>> işareti ile komut arasında boşluk bırakmalarıdır. Bu durumda kodlar çalışmayacaktır.
Wing IDE:
https://wingware.com/downloads/wingide-101 adresinden indirilebilirsiniz.
Wing IDE Professional, Wing IDE Personal ve Wing IDE 101 olmak üzere üç çeşidi vardır. Bunlardan Wing IDE 101 ücretsizdir.
Canopy: https://store.enthought.com/downloads/#default adresinden ücretsiz indirilebilirsiniz.
Pycharm:https://www.jetbrains.com/pycharm/
Not: Editörler bu programlarla sınırlı değildir. İstediğiniz editörü seçmek size kalmıştır. Bu tamamen kullanım alışkanlıkları ve kullanım kolaylığı gibi faktörlere bağlıdır.
PROGLAMLAMA KAVRAMLARI:
Derleyiciler : Kaynak kodları hedef kodlara dönüştürür.
Yorumlayıcılar : Kaynak kodları hedef kodlara dönüştürmekle beraber programın çalışmasını tekrarlar. Python, yorumlanan bir dildir.
Yanaylaçlar : Programın çalışmasıyla ilgili istatistiki veri toplar.
Hata Ayıklayıcılar (Debugging): Programdaki hataları bulur.
Yorumlar: Python ’da kodlar zamanla karmaşık hâle gelir ve bu da okumayı zorlaştırır. Bunun için kodlara açıklama eklenmesi gerekebilir. # işareti ile program içerisine yorum yazmak mümkündür. Programlama dili, yorumları göz ardı eder ve kod yapısı bozulmaz.
Yorumlar
Yorum Gönder